Unit 1. Preparing Resource¶
Before building a model to predict turbine engine temperature rises, you need to request the PVC storage resource for AI Pipelines to design a prediction pipeline and for AI Lab if you want to process model files in a Notebook instance.
Requesting Storage Resource¶
To design a pipeline or use Notebook instances, request PVC storage from the resource pool by the following steps:
- Log in to EnOS Management Console and select Data Analytics > Resource Configuration > Storage Configuration from the left navigation pane. 
- Select Add PVC on the PVC Management tab. 
- Configure the following information in the popup window. - Filed - Description - Name - Enter - temp-rise-pipeline.- Capacity - Enter - 5GB.- Access Mode - Select Shared. - Used By - Select Pipeline.

- Select Confirm to request the PVC resource.
